JsPlumb - 基本设置建议

JsPlumb - Basic setup advice

之前没用过jsplumb,看了一些文档,看过了demo,还是没看懂..

我想创建一个这样的 DIV :

一个输入和最多 8 个输出(此值可能会更改) 我该怎么做呢 ?

我将考虑克隆此 div 并增加 div 的 ID,因此我最终可能会得到两个或更多需要能够加入的 div像这样。

任何人都可以帮助解决这个问题或给我一些简单的例子..

谢谢

您需要将较大的 div 添加为目标端点,将较小的 div 添加为源端点。

 var e1 =  jsPlumb.addEndpoint(idSource, sourceEndpoint);
        var e2 =  jsPlumb.addEndpoint(idTarget, targetEndpoint);

其中 sourceEndpoint 和 targetEndpoints 是定义端点外观和行为的对象。

查看其中一个示例以获得您想要的行为。 然后 jsPlumb 应该允许您将连接从源拖放到目标。 状态机演示几乎可以满足您的需求。

http://www.jsplumb.org/demo/flowchart/dom.html